Uber Technologies (NYSE:UBER) is adding in-app hotel booking through a new partnership with Expedia. The tie up opens access to more than 700,000 hotels directly inside the Uber app. Features include planned vacation rental integration, curated trip tools, and AI powered booking assistance.
